Running the interpreter

# Run any .sten file this would be our main format 
python steno.py run examples/hello_world.sten

# Run all 5 examples at once --> prob use during class
python steno.py demo

# Interactive REPL 
python steno.py

# Transpile to Python (backup/export)
python steno.py compile examples/fizzbuzz.sten

# Debug tools
python steno.py tokens examples/fizzbuzz.sten   # token stream
python steno.py ast    examples/fizzbuzz.sten   # AST dump
python steno.py check  examples/fizzbuzz.sten   # syntax check only

STENO Token Reference

Short token Long-form alias Python equivalent
lp i .. 0 10 for i .. 0 10 for i in range(0, 10):
lp x items for x items for x in items:
wh x > 0 while x > 0 while x > 0:
fn add a b def add a b def add(a, b):
cl Stack class Stack class Stack:
rt x + y return x + y return x + y
if x > 0 if x > 0 if x > 0:
el else else:
el if x == 0 else if x == 0 elif x == 0:
pr "hello" print "hello" print("hello")
vr x = 5 var x = 5 x = 5
im math import math import math
fr math im sqrt from math im sqrt from math import sqrt
tr try try:
ex Exception except Exception except Exception:
br / ct / ps break / continue / pass same
[x fr items if c] [x for x in items if c]

Architecture

your_file.sten
      │
      ▼  lexer.py
   Token stream   (TT enum, Token dataclass)
      │
      ▼  parser.py
   AST             (ast_nodes.py dataclasses)
      │
      ├──▶  interpreter.py   (tree-walk, direct execution)
      │
      └──▶  transpiler.py    (AST → Python source string)

steno.py wires everything together and provides the CLI + REPL.
